Fans of RuPaul’s Drag Race, start your engines and head down to Oswaldtwistle for a star performance by Divina De Campo in October.

The sassy runner up on the first series of RuPaul’s Drag Race is featuring in an exclusive show ‘An Audience with Divina De Campo', at Civic Arts Centre and Theatre on Thursday, October 13.

The fantastic show will feature Divina wowing the audience with performances of her favourite songs and the crowd will be able to interact with the drag queen during the event.

The talented Divina has also featured on national television shows including The Voice, and All Together Now.

The organisers of the event shared their excitement over the "biggest announcement they’ve ever made".

Gayle Knight, Creative Director at the Civic Arts Centre and Theatre said: “Naturally, we’re thrilled to have Divina come to our theatre, we’re all huge fans and are looking forward to a fantastic evening."

The Civic Arts Centre and Theatre is a centre for all forms of arts including dance, drama, music, musical theatre, singing, crafts, photography and much more right in the heart of Hyndburn.

Gayle continued: “Divina coming to us is part of the changes we’re making to the way we run the theatre and one of the many big artists that we have lined up over the coming year, with more announcements to follow soon.”

Owen Farrow, who goes by the stage name of Divina De Campo, is “a seasoned British drag queen and singer” known by fans for her high soprano and 4-octave range.

Her love of theatre led her to star in stage productions including The Ruby Slippers, a play that explores prejudice in the LGBT community, and Dancing Bear, a musical that explores faith, sexuality and gender identity.
